检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:王映辉[1] 王立福[2] 张世琨[2] 王琼芳[1]
机构地区:[1]陕西师范大学计算机学院,陕西西安710062 [2]北京大学软件研究所,北京100871
出 处:《电子学报》2006年第8期1428-1432,共5页Acta Electronica Sinica
基 金:国家863高技术研究发展计划(No.2001AA113171);国家973重点基础研究发展规划(No.2002CB312006);国家博士后基金(No.20040350251)
摘 要:有效的软件变化追踪方法是实施软件演化的关键.基于需求信息传播与建模、需求变化信息传播路径和需求变化信息跟踪方法三个层面,阐述了软件变化跟踪的整体过程框架;给出了基于变化起源跟踪矩阵、变化对象跟踪矩阵、变化构件跟踪矩阵、以及可达矩阵的功能变化传播记录方法;凭借矩阵运算,描述了功能变化跟踪的具体实现,并给出了实施变化所付出代价高低的初步判定方法.对软件维护甚至软件演化研究具有一定的借鉴意义.It's a key of software evolution to achieve available method of software change-trace. A whole traceprocess framework of requirement change is drawn based on three tiers which are propagation & modeling, propagation path, and trace approach of requirement change. Record method about propagation of function-requirement change is addressed based on trace-matrix of change-source ,of change-object and of change component. Implementation of changetrace based matrixcalculation is described, and a simple cost decision method of software change-implementation is brought forward. It is advantage to implement software maintenance as well as software evolution.
分 类 号:TP311.13[自动化与计算机技术—计算机软件与理论]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.112